Jeffrey P. Gaboury
About
Jeffrey P. Gaboury has authored 8 papers that have received a total of 924 indexed citations.
This includes 5 papers in Immunology, 4 papers in Physiology and 3 papers in Molecular Biology. The topics of these papers are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(4 papers), Mast cells and histamine (3 papers) and Coagulation, Bradykinin, Polyphosphates, and Angioedema (3 papers). Jeffrey P. Gaboury is often cited by papers focused on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(4 papers), Mast cells and histamine (3 papers) and Coagulation, Bradykinin, Polyphosphates, and Angioedema (3 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Canada. Jeffrey P. Gaboury's co-authors include Paul Kubes, Brent Johnston, Makoto Suematsu, Xiaofei Niu and Paul Reinhardt and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, The Journal of Immunology and The FASEB Journal.
